Adonis Ladybird
Hippodamia variegata
The body length of the Adonis Ladybird ranges from 4 to 5 mm. The body is more elongated than that of other ladybirds, and the number of spots varies from 3 to 15, with the majority positioned towards the rear. These ladybirds are often found on wild carrot and other low vegetation during warm summer days.
